Outcome Measures

Primary Outcomes (1)

  • Collect and analyze descriptive characteristics of patient population and summarize patient outcome data.

    up to 20 years

Secondary Outcomes (4)

  • Correlate the patient characteristics to the surgical outcomes.

    up to 20 years

  • Determine the overall survival

    up to 20 years

  • Determine the rate of local recurrence in patients undergoing robotic prostatectomy and compare these metrics to historical controls.

    up to 20 years

  • disease- free survival

    up to 20 years
